A silver late medieval, penny, probably Henry VI-Edward IV, AD.1422-1483. The coin is worn and largely illegible. The coin also seems to have been clipped down around the edge of the flan. Obverse, traces of crown. Reverse, a long cross with three pellets in angles. The coin measures 14.5mm diameter, 0.5mm thick and weighs 0.5 grams..

An incomplete silver, medieval, voided short cross penny, Henry II -Henry III, AD.1180-1247 which has broken into two parts. Obverse, worn bust facing with sceptre, hENRIC[VS R]EX Reverse, voided short cross with quatrefoils in angles, +[RAV.] ON [L]VND The coin measures 19.2mm diameter, 0.8mm thick and the two sections together weigh 1 gram.

A worn Medieval or Post Medieval cast lead alloy uniface circular token. (AD c1250-1800). The token has a raised design of an eight spoke like a cart wheel, on one side. There are raised pellets between each spoke. The reverse has a further raised design of four triangular petals joined together with a circular ring. The token measures 18.3mm diameter, 2.1mm thick and weighs 3.8 grams. The token is a greyish white in colour.
